The Hypertension Score in 06511, New Haven, Connecticut is 58 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

51.54 percent of the population in 06511 drive to work alone. 11.35 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 77.44 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 7.70 percent of the residents in 06511 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.32 members with about 1.31 cars available per household.

An estimate of 92.44 percent of the residents in 06511 has some form of health insurance. 39.30 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 57.76 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 06511 would have to travel an average of 1.05 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Yale-New Haven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 06511, New Haven, Connecticut.

As of , an estimate of 54,856 residents live in 06511 with a median age of 29.1 years. 19.71 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 8.11 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 43.92 percent of the residents in 06511 is currently married, and 36.02 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 06511 is $4,757.33.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 06511 is approximately $1,401. The median household spends about 29.45 percent of their income on housing.

Accessibility of Healthcare for Individuals with Hypertension

Hypertension, commonly known as high blood pressure, is a prevalent condition that affects millions of Americans. It requires ongoing medical management to control blood pressure levels and reduce the risk of related complications such as heart disease and stroke. Access to healthcare providers and regular appointments are essential for individuals with Hypertension to monitor their condition and adjust treatment as needed.

When individuals with Hypertension miss provider appointments due to lack of access or transportation barriers, it can lead to worsening health outcomes and increased healthcare costs. Uncontrolled Hypertension can result in emergency room visits, hospitalizations, and additional medical expenses that could have been prevented with proper ongoing care.
